Employers Sending Employees to Private Exchanges
Instead of purchasing insurance for their employees, some employers are providing a defined contribution and sending them to private exchanges to buy individual coverage. This seems fine to me if you are healthy, but what if you are not?

Why Patients Are Not Consumers
Conservatives consistently say how having "skin in the game" will control the cost of health care. Given what I have seen of how little people understand about their health care insurance, I have always had my doubts about how these same individuals transform into super-educated consumers of health care, particularly when good cost and quality data are still not available.
